The High Temperature Coatings Market was valued at USD 6.11 billion in 2023, expected to reach USD 6.36 billion in 2024, and is projected to grow at a CAGR of 4.26%, to USD 8.19 billion by 2030.

High temperature coatings are specialized materials designed to withstand extreme temperatures, typically above 200°C, without degrading. These coatings are essential for protecting structures and machinery in industries such as aerospace, automotive, marine, and industrial manufacturing where high heat is generated. They serve several purposes, including corrosion resistance, thermal insulation, and improving the longevity and efficiency of components. The increasing demand from the automotive and aerospace sectors for more efficient and durable materials is a key growth driver, coupled with advancements in construction and industrial equipment which often require such high-performance coatings. The rapid industrialization in developing economies adds to the burgeoning market demand, as infrastructure development accelerates.

However, the market faces limitations due to the high cost of raw materials and stringent environmental regulations which can inhibit the adoption of certain high temperature coatings. Advanced research in nanotechnology and smart coatings presents significant opportunities for innovation. By investing in these areas, businesses can develop coatings that not only offer heat resistance but also self-healing properties, thereby enhancing performance and lifespan. Additionally, increased focus on eco-friendly and sustainable coatings could align with global environmental initiatives, presenting another avenue for growth. Market players are recommended to leverage collaborations and partnerships with research institutions to remain ahead in the technological curve.

Challenges remain due to supply chain disruptions which can affect raw material availability, alongside technological barriers that smaller companies may face in adopting innovative processes.
